
Satura rādītājs:
2025 Autors: Lynn Donovan | [email protected]. Pēdējoreiz modificēts: 2025-01-22 17:33
Saglabāta procedūra Oracle
Oracle's datu bāzes valoda, PL/SQL , sastāv no uzglabātās procedūras , kas veido lietojumprogrammas Oracle's datu bāze. IT speciālisti izmanto glabājas programmas iekšā Oracle's datubāze, lai pareizi rakstītu un pārbaudītu kodu, un šīs programmas kļūst uzglabātās procedūras reiz sastādīts
Ņemot to vērā, kur tiek glabātas Oracle procedūras?
A saglabātā procedūra netiek pārkompilēts katru reizi, kad tas tiek izsaukts. Procedūras var būt glabājas datu bāzē, izmantojot Orākuls rīki, piemēram, SQL*Plus. Jūs izveidojat avotu procedūru izmantojot teksta redaktoru, un izpildiet avotu, izmantojot SQL*Plus (piemēram, ar operatoru @).
kam tiek izmantotas saglabātās procedūras? Uzglabātās procedūras var izpildīt SQL priekšrakstus, izmantot nosacījumu loģiku, piemēram, IF THEN vai CASE priekšrakstus un cirpšanas konstrukcijas, lai veiktu uzdevumus. A saglabātā procedūra spēj piezvanīt citam saglabātā procedūra . Saglabātā procedūra var kļūt ļoti ērti, jo tie var manipulēt ar SQL vaicājumu rezultātiem, izmantojot kursorus.
Attiecībā uz to, kāda ir procedūra Oracle ar piemēru?
A procedūru ir grupa no PL/SQL paziņojumus, kurus varat saukt vārdā. Zvana specifikācija (dažreiz saukta par zvana specifikāciju) deklarē Java metodi vai trešās paaudzes valodas (3GL) rutīnu, lai to varētu izsaukt no SQL un PL/SQL . Zvana specifikācija stāsta Orākuls Datu bāze, kura Java metode jāizsauc, kad tiek veikts zvans.
Kādas ir procedūras DBVS?
"A procedūras vai funkcija ir grupa vai kopa SQL un PL/ SQL apgalvojumi, kas veic konkrētu uzdevumu." Galvenā atšķirība starp a procedūru un funkcija ir, funkcijai vienmēr ir jāatgriež vērtība, bet a procedūru var vai nevar atgriezt vērtību.
Ieteicams:
Kur SQL Server tiek glabātas procedūras?

Saglabātā procedūra (sp) ir SQL pieprasījumu grupa, kas tiek saglabāta datu bāzē. SSMS tos var atrast tieši pie galdiem. Faktiski programmatūras arhitektūras ziņā ir labāk saglabāt T-SQL valodu datu bāzē, jo, mainoties līmenim, nav nepieciešams modificēt citu
Kādas ir Oracle procedūras?

Procedūra ir apakšprogrammas vienība, kas sastāv no PL/SQL priekšrakstu grupas. Katrai Oracle procedūrai ir savs unikālais nosaukums, ar kuru uz to var atsaukties. Šī apakšprogrammas vienība tiek saglabāta kā datu bāzes objekts. Vērtības var nodot procedūrā vai iegūt no procedūras, izmantojot parametrus
Kur SQL Server tiek glabātas globālās pagaidu tabulas?

Globālās pagaidu tabulas SQL Server (kas iniciētas ar ## tabulas nosaukumu) tiek glabātas tempdb un tiek koplietotas starp visām lietotāju sesijām visā SQL Server instancē. Azure SQL datu bāze atbalsta globālās pagaidu tabulas, kas tiek glabātas arī tempdb un ietvertas datu bāzes līmenī
Kur tiek glabātas GitLab krātuves?

Pēc noklusējuma Omnibus GitLab saglabā Git repozitorija datus mapē /var/opt/gitlab/git-data. Krātuves tiek glabātas apakšmapes repozitorijās. Varat mainīt git-data vecāku direktorija atrašanās vietu, pievienojot šādu rindiņu /etc/gitlab/gitlab. rb
Kur tiek glabātas procedūras SQL Server?

Saglabātā procedūra (sp) ir SQL pieprasījumu grupa, kas tiek saglabāta datu bāzē. SSMS tos var atrast tieši pie galdiem